11 Day Catamaran Escapade Around Southern Thailand's Most Stunning Islands

Climb aboard & join us on an epic 11-day voyage around southern Thailand's most stunning islands.
Departure was greeted by a downpour, at our anchorage in Chalong Bay, but the skies soon cleared as we set sail for Koh Racha Noi, & Koh Racha Yai. Snorkeling, Wing Foiling, Tow-Foiling, and the sharing of cold brews, were savored in these beautiful archipelagos.
With a new day's sunrise, came a new destination; Koh Lipe, via an overnight passage in Koh Rok's lightning-filled horizon.
The following day's advance to Koh Lipe, buoyed by 20-knot winds, was the sailing highlight of the trip, with not another vessel in sight, our lone Catamarn dancing to the pulse of the rapturous Andaman Ocean, for 5 hours.
Dropping anchor off of Sunrise Beach, we headed inland to explore this alluring island, marveling at the coral-filled crystalline waters, the pristine beaches, and the incredible, island-framed panoramas. We were fortunate to catch a squall just off of Sunset Beach, and consequently, Wing Foiled amongst this magical setting, before heading off to Koh Muk, the following day.
Arriving at Koh Muk to bruised skies, we stepped ashore and hiked through the jungle, as the clouds burst above us. We topped up with supplies in town, then headed back to the coastline, where we traversed the majestic limestone cliffs, to access the Emerald Cave's ethereal sanctuary.
Our next stop was Koh Jum; a charming island, with a calm, unhurried vibe, and invigorating rhythm. There are no bank ATMs, or 711's on this island, and in their absence, a tight community economy, with more locally sourced culinary offerings, is prevalent.
Before heading back home, our final destination was the Phi Phi Islands. Here we enjoyed Diving amongst the vibrant coral, an evening of Tow-Foiling, and a final clinking of glasses under the spectacular Andaman sunset.
